Description

Students use their math and organizational skills to plan, create and manage a budget to build a Gingerbread House. The Gingerbread House Project can be a stand alone activity OR is the PERFECT anchor lesson to building a candy house using graham crackers and candy. Math skills used include measurement (perimeter, area, volume etc.,), money, estimation, addition, subtraction, and multiplication.
